Cabbage with Vinegar
My children loved this very simple, easy to prepare dish with finely sliced cabbage and white vinegar. It is best suited to be served with stews and gumbos.

Ingredients

6 servings
  • 1 fresh head of cabbage, small
  • 1/2 cup low-acidic white vinegar
  • 1/4 cup water
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Step-by-Step Instructions

  1. Using a large, sharp knife, finely slice the cabbage. It will look like straw when done.
  2. Combine the vinegar and water. I find the least expensive off-brand vinegar tastes the best. Pour over the cabbage in a large bowl. Depending on the yield of the cabbage, you can adjust the liquid. You want the cabbage coated but not swimming in liquid. Add black pepper and salt to taste and mix all ingredients thoroughly. Goes great with gumbos or stews.

Tips and Techniques

The least expensive, off-brand white vinegar often has the mildest, most balanced flavor for this dish. Slice the cabbage as thinly as possible for the best texture—it should look like delicate straw.

Ingredient Substitutions

  • white vinegar: apple cider vinegar or rice vinegar
  • fresh cabbage: coleslaw mix
